How courts have described this case
Verbatim parenthetical descriptions written by other courts when citing this decision. Ranked by citation-network relevance.
- stating that “this Court has definitively expressed that certiorari cannot be used to grant a second appeal to correct the existence of mere legal error”
- finding the Third District’s decision in De Ferrari “inapposite” because it pertained to “uninsured motorist benefits, and did not address PIP coverage”
- equating analysis of whether circuit court applied the correct law to whether it departed from the essential requirements of law
